Samsung t239

On the heels of the Samsung t349 announcement, T-Mobile USA is preparing to add yet another Samsung phone to its portfolio. Again, we’re talking about an entry-level device, which unlike the phone we discussed earlier, doesn’t come with a half-QWERTY keyboard. It’s the slider-shaped Samsung t239 that prides itself with dual-band GSM connectivity, 177×220 pixels screen, Bluetooth, myFaves and Web2go support, and VGA camera.

We’re hearing T-Mobile will offer this baby for $59.99 on the pay-as-you-go basis (prepaid) or for free with any contract signed. When will this actually happen, we’re not sure…
